This is an old post - for an up-to-date guide see Flow Cookbook: Flow & React. Flow v0.11 was released recently. The latest set of changes really improve type checking in React apps. But there are some guidelines to follow to get the full benefits. Use ES6 classes React added support in version 0.13 for implementing components as native Javascript classes (more information on that here). The lates